Abstract :
Recovering camera orientation with respect to a known coordinate system is of great significance to photogrammetry and binocular stereo. In binocular stereo, the relative orientation between a camera pair may be obtained from the orientation of each camera with respect to a common frame. In this paper a Fourier technique is presented to determine the orientation of a camera with respect to a calibration object. This technique is limited to orthographic projection, but has two major strengths of; being very accurate, and the camera orientation being entirely decoupled from translation
